§ 70-415.279. Appropriations and purpose.

  • Expenditures from the fund shall be used by the City of New Orleans to build, maintain, clean, manage, beautify, improve, operate, repair, replace, implement and/or upkeep drainage and other infrastructure projects in the City of New Orleans, including but not limited to the following:

    (1)

    Equipment and technology upgrades;

    (2)

    Streets rated poor or worse by the Citywide Pavement Assessment;

    (3)

    Broken or damaged catch basins and boxes;

    (4)

    Lids or frames covering catch basins that are broken or missing;

    (5)

    Enforce rules, regulations, and laws regarding putting refuse or debris in catch basins by individuals, companies, or nonprofits;

    (6)

    Design, create and implement sustainable water management principles and best practices that deal with flooding caused by heavy rainfall, subsidence caused by the pumping of storm water and water assets;

    (7)

    Bridges and overpasses, including lighting and debris removal;

    (8)

    Drainage canals and adjacent areas;

    (9)

    Transportation projects;

    (10)

    Sewer and drainage lines, as needed;

    (11)

    Professional development opportunities to train for employment or employ residents to perform the aforementioned work, as needed; and

    (12)

    Pedestrian, bike and other safety improvements.

(M.C.S., Ord. No. 27986, § 1, 1-24-19)
